Factors Affecting Cost
- Slope Gradient: Steeper slopes may require more extensive drainage solutions.
- Soil Type: Different soil types can impact the complexity and materials needed.
- Drainage System Type: Choices between French drains, surface drains, or other systems affect costs.
- Site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may increase labor and equipment expenses.
- Permits and Regulations: Local regulations and necessary permits can add to the overall cost.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ials typically come at a higher price.
- Labor Costs: The cost of labor can vary depending on the expertise and rates of local contractors.
- Project Size: Larger projects generally incur higher costs due to the increased scope of work.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ost Range |
---|---|
Initial Site Assessment | $100 - $300 |
Basic French Drain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Advanced French Drain Installation | $3,000 - $6,000 |
Surface Drain Installation | $1,500 - $4,000 |
Erosion Control Measures | $500 - $2,500 |
Permits and Inspection Fees | $50 - $200 |
Excavation and Grading | $1,000 - $5,000 |
Material Costs (pipes, gravel) | $500 - $2,000 |
